Spanish striker Alvaro Morata responded to the media’s persistent questions regarding his future this summer.
The Spanish number 9 was recently linked as a top target for Daniele De Rossi’s Roma.
Morata impressed during the Spain-Croatia match at the Olympiastadion in Berlin, scoring the first goal for the Red Furies.
The ex-Juve man has long been in the sights of several Italian teams, including Roma, who would like to strengthen their offensive department with the player who is said to be a favorite of De Rossi’s.
Speaking to Corriere dello Sport, the player hinted at a possible return to Italy with a joke: “Am I going back to Italy? Sure, on holiday.”
This comment further fueled hopes for his return, suggesting that a possible Italian destination could be on the table.
